About The Role
We are looking for a driven DevSecOps Lead to join our engineering organization and help shape how we build, secure and operate cloud-native products at scale.
You are a hands-on leader passionate about building secure, scalable, and high-performing platforms. You combine deep AWS expertise with strong product security principles, embedding security into every stage of the development lifecycle.
What would you do?
- Act as a technical leader driving DevSecOps practices across engineering teams
- Embed, maintain and optimise security into CI/CD pipelines and product development workflows for cloud-native and AI-driven projects
- Design and evolve secure AWS architectures supporting high-availability SaaS products
- Partner with product and engineering teams to shift security left and improve developer experience
- Partner with AWS security and account teams to implement and track security checks and best practices (e.g. ESSR findings, AWS Security Hub, AWS Guard Duty etc.)
- Lead threat modelling, risk assessments and security reviews for new and existing services
- Drive automation and AI across infrastructure, security controls and compliance processes
- Build and promote a strong security-first engineering culture
